Police Reports for May 8

Posted

Sedalia Police Department

Arrests

May 6

8:12 p.m.: Jacob Michael Burgher, 24, was arrested after being observed in the vehicle when the registered owner had a revoked license. He was stopped at East Second Street and South Ohio Avenue and was released with a municipal court summons for driving while revoked. 

8:33 p.m.: Lucas Lones, 47, was arrested for failing to maintain his lane on Broadway Boulevard near Thompson Avenue. The driver had a revoked driver's license and was issued a municipal summons. 

9:31 p.m.: Omar Gonzalez, 29, was arrested after officers conducted a traffic stop at the intersection of West 16th Street and South Kentucky Avenue. The driver did not have a valid license and was transported to the police department and released with a citation. 

Incidents

May 5

3:53 p.m.: An officer was dispatched to the lobby of the Sedalia Police Department for a theft report of a license plate that occurred two weeks ago.

May 6

2:03 p.m.: An officer responded to the police department lobby for a reported fraud. They gathered information and completed a report. 

6:23 p.m.: Officers were dispatched to a call of suspicious circumstances in the 400 block of Albright Court. Information was gathered for a report. 

7:55 p.m.: Officers met with individuals in the police department lobby regarding a bike theft report In the 800 block of South Limit Avenue. A report was made on the incident. 

May 7

12:48 a.m.: A pursuit was initiated for a vehicle near East Fifth Street and South Lafayette Avenue. The driver was known to the officer. The pursuit was terminated and charges of driving while suspended and felony aggravated fleeing are being requested.
